Output 30e8693507b6514f9ae3e86ef41b62b540c7a5930c71cd97ba585c591f209c48:20

value
99699406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238526b4c2bc4762f37a50891017c723f0688d19 OP_EQUAL
address
34vq5mKzt9HJCGSwLNhiCxLnKCR6Z5WEay
transaction
30e8693507b6514f9ae3e86ef41b62b540c7a5930c71cd97ba585c591f209c48
spent
true